Creamy Street Corn Pasta Salad (Printable)

Vibrant pasta salad with roasted corn, creamy cheese dressing, and zesty lime mayo for ultimate summer flavor.

# What You'll Need:

→ Creamy Cheese Dressing

01 - 4 oz cream cheese, room temperature
02 - 1/3 cup sour cream
03 - 2 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
04 - 1-2 cloves garlic, freshly grated
05 - 1 tbsp fresh chives, chopped
06 - 3/4 cup crumbled cotija cheese (or feta)
07 - Sal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ste

→ Salad Components

08 - 1 lb short pasta (rotini, fusilli, or farfalle)
09 - 1 head romaine lettuce, shredded
10 - 2 cups grilled or roasted corn (from 3-4 fresh ears or frozen, thawed)
11 - 1/2 cup spicy cheddar cheese, diced
12 - 1/2 cup fresh basil leaves, torn
13 - 1/2 cup fresh cilantro, chopped
14 - 1 medium avocado, diced

→ Chili Butter

15 - 4 tbsp salted butter
16 - 2 tbsp chili powder
17 - 2 tsp smoked paprika
18 - 1/2-2 tsp cayenne pepper (to taste)
19 - Pinch of salt

→ Lime Mayo Dressing

20 - 1/4 cup mayonnaise (or plain yogurt)
21 - 2 tbsp fresh lime juice
22 - Pinch of salt

# How to Make It:

01 - In a large salad bowl, combine the cream cheese, sour cream, olive oil, grated garlic, chopped chives, and crumbled cotija cheese.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Mix until smooth and set aside.
02 -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the pasta and cook until al dente according to package instructions. Drain well. While still warm, toss the pasta with the creamy cheese dressing in the salad bowl.
03 - Add shredded romaine, grilled or roasted corn, diced spicy cheddar cheese, torn basil, chopped cilantro, and diced avocado to the dressed pasta. Gently toss until well mixed and evenly coated.
04 - In a skillet over medium heat, melt the butter until golden and fragrant. Stir in chili powder, smoked paprika, cayenne pepper to your spice preference, and a pinch of salt. Let the spices bloom for about 1 minute, then remove from heat.
05 - In a small bowl, whisk together mayonnaise (or yogurt), fresh lime juice, and a pinch of salt until smooth and fully incorporated.
06 - Serve the salad warm or chilled. Drizzle with the lime mayo dressing and spoon over the spicy chili butter just before serving. For optimal flavor development, let the salad rest for 10-15 minutes before serving to allow flavors to meld together.

02 -
  • Tossing the warm pasta with the cheese dressing immediately is crucial for maximum flavor absorption
  • The salad needs those 10 to 15 minutes of resting time for the flavors to really come together
  • Add the avocado right before serving if you are making this ahead to prevent browning
03 -
  • Save some fresh herbs and cotija to sprinkle on top for that gorgeous restaurant style presentation
  • If the chili butter solidifies in the fridge just give it a quick zap in the microwave
